Kidney bean and chicken soup
Description
This is a high protein soup, perfect for after you've been working out. It also has lots of carbs and fibre from the beans.
Ingredients
Amounts per serving, multiply by number of people
50g Dried kidney beans (which have soaked over night)
160g Turnip (note this is about half a grapefruit sized turnip), chopped
Half a medium onion, chopped
Cup of spinach
3 oz boneless, skinless chicken breast, baked and torn to pieces
Coriander
Cardomom
Cumin
Salt
Pepper
Instructions
Put the kidney beans, chopped turnip, and chopped oinions in a pot of water.
Bring the water to a boil, then reduce the heat to let the contents simmer.
Add the spices to taste. (I like lots)
When the turnip is soft, toss in the spinach, and the chicken.
Once the spinach is lightly cooked (a couple minutes generally), it is ready to serve.
